At the Peter Grünberg Institute - Integrated Computing Architectures (PGI-4/ICA), we design integrated circuits that enable scalable control and readout of semiconductor spin qubits at cryogenic temperatures. A key challenge in quantum computing is the efficient control of many qubits under strict constraints on wiring, heat load, noise, and area.
Our group focuses on system-level design and modeling of cryogenic electronics, bridging quantum devices and advanced IC design. We develop and analyze electronic architectures that operate in close interaction with experimental setups, providing the foundation for scalable quantum processors.
In this interdisciplinary Master project, you will design, model, and simulate cryogenic control electronics for scalable electron-spin qubit systems. The core challenge is enabling multi-qubit control while minimizing wiring overhead, heat load, and noise at millikelvin temperatures.
